OTP là gì? Tìm hiểu định nghĩa, chức năng và lợi ích của mã OTP trong bảo mật thông tin

Cover Image
“`html

Trong thời đại công nghệ số hiện nay, việc bảo vệ thông tin cá nhân và tài khoản trực tuyến là điều vô cùng quan trọng. Một trong những giải pháp hiệu quả nhất để tăng cường bảo mật chính là OTP, viết tắt của One-Time Password (mật khẩu dùng một lần). Bài viết này sẽ giúp bạn hiểu rõ hơn về OTP, từ định nghĩa OTP đến chức năng của OTPlợi ích của OTP trong lĩnh vực bảo mật thông tin.

Mã OTP là gì

1. Định nghĩa OTP

Mã OTP, hay còn gọi là mật khẩu dùng một lần, là một dạng mã số hoặc chuỗi ký tự được sinh ra để xác thực danh tính người dùng trong các giao dịch trực tuyến. Mã OTP là gì? Đó là một mã xác thực có hiệu lực trong một khoảng thời gian ngắn và chỉ có thể sử dụng một lần duy nhất. Điều này có nghĩa là ngay cả khi ai đó biết được mã OTP, họ cũng không thể sử dụng nó cho lần tiếp theo, điều này giúp tăng cường an toàn cho tài khoản của bạn.

Nguồn gốc và ngữ nghĩa của OTP

Nguồn gốc OTP

Thuật ngữ OTP bắt nguồn từ khái niệm bảo mật trong các giao dịch điện tử. Mã OTP thường được tạo ra một cách ngẫu nhiên và được gửi đến thiết bị đã đăng ký của người dùng qua các kênh như SMS, email hoặc những ứng dụng xác thực. Việc sử dụng OTP trong bảo mật trở thành tiêu chuẩn, người dùng chỉ có thể thực hiện giao dịch khi họ cung cấp mã này.

2. Chức năng của OTP

OTP không chỉ đơn thuần là một mã số mà còn mang lại nhiều chức năng của OTP bảo mật quan trọng. Chúng hoạt động như một lớp bảo vệ bổ sung cho tài khoản của bạn, ngăn chặn nguy cơ bị truy cập trái phép. Những chức năng chính của OTP bao gồm:

  • Xác thực giao dịch tài chính: OTP được yêu cầu khi bạn thực hiện các giao dịch tài chính như chuyển tiền hoặc thanh toán hóa đơn, đảm bảo rằng chỉ có người dùng hợp pháp mới có thể thực hiện.
  • Đăng nhập an toàn: Người dùng cũng có thể sử dụng OTP để đăng nhập vào các dịch vụ trực tuyến, tăng cường độ bảo mật cho tài khoản cá nhân.
  • Ngăn chặn hành vi xâm nhập trái phép: Bằng cách yêu cầu mã OTP, ngay cả khi kẻ gian sở hữu mật khẩu chính, họ cũng không thể truy cập tài khoản mà không có mã này.
See also  Số chính phương là gì? Định nghĩa, tính chất và ứng dụng trong toán học

Chức năng của OTP

3. Cách sử dụng OTP

Việc sử dụng OTP rất đơn giản và nhanh chóng. Quy trình thông thường khi sử dụng OTP bao gồm các bước sau đây:

  • Nhận OTP: Khi người dùng thực hiện một giao dịch, hệ thống sẽ gửi mã OTP đến thiết bị đã đăng ký của bạn qua SMS, email hoặc ứng dụng xác thực.
  • Nhập mã OTP: Sau khi nhận mã, người dùng chỉ có một khoảng thời gian ngắn (thường từ 30 giây đến 2 phút) để nhập mã vào hệ thống và hoàn tất giao dịch.

Nhờ vào cách sử dụng đơn giản này, OTP trở thành một phương pháp bảo mật lý tưởng cho nhiều người dùng hiện nay.

4. Lợi ích của OTP

OTP mang lại hàng loạt lợi ích của OTP đáng kể, không chỉ giúp cải thiện bảo mật mà còn làm giảm nguy cơ tấn công mạng. Dưới đây là một số lợi ích nổi bật của OTP:

  • Tăng cường bảo mật: Do mã OTP chỉ có hiệu lực trong một khoảng thời gian ngắn và không thể bị tái sử dụng, nó giúp hạn chế nguy cơ bị đánh cắp thông tin.
  • Giảm nguy cơ tấn công mạng: Nếu kẻ gian đã biết mật khẩu của bạn, họ vẫn không thể thực hiện giao dịch nếu không có mã OTP, tạo ra một lớp bảo vệ bổ sung.
  • Ứng dụng rộng rãi: OTP trong ngân hàng và các lĩnh vực khác như thương mại điện tử, mạng xã hội và các dịch vụ trực tuyến khác, đảm bảo rằng người dùng có thể an tâm khi sử dụng các dịch vụ trên mạng.
See also  Thông tin là gì? Tầm quan trọng, ý nghĩa và mối quan hệ với dữ liệu trong cuộc sống hiện đại

5. OTP trong bảo mật

Trong lĩnh vực tài chính, OTP đóng một vai trò quan trọng. Các giao dịch ngân hàng trực tuyến, bảo mật tài khoản thẻ tín dụng, và các dịch vụ tài chính trực tuyến khác đều có thể sử dụng OTP như một biện pháp bảo vệ hiệu quả. Hệ thống OTP bảo mật hiện nay như TOTP (Time-Based One-Time Password) và HOTP (HMAC-Based One-Time Password) đã giúp nâng cao hiệu quả sử dụng của OTP cả về thời gian và độ chính xác.

OTP trong bảo mật

6. So sánh OTP và mật khẩu truyền thống

Tiêu chí OTP Mật khẩu truyền thống
Độ bảo mật Rất cao Thấp hơn, dễ bị đánh cắp
Hiệu lực Chỉ có hiệu lực một lần, thời gian ngắn Sử dụng nhiều lần
Rủi ro khi lộ thông tin Thấp, không thể tái sử dụng được Cao, có thể bị khai thác nhiều lần

So với mật khẩu truyền thống, OTP tỏ ra ưu việt hơn về độ bảo mật, giúp người dùng an tâm hơn khi thực hiện các giao dịch trực tuyến.

7. Quy trình OTP

Quy trình sử dụng OTP diễn ra từ khi người dùng yêu cầu mã cho đến khi nhập mã. Thường có một số bước quan trọng trong quy trình này:

  • Người dùng thực hiện giao dịch và yêu cầu hệ thống gửi mã OTP.
  • Hệ thống tạo ra mã và gửi đến thiết bị của người dùng.
  • Người dùng nhận mã và nhập mã vào hệ thống để hoàn tất giao dịch.

Các lỗi thường gặp và cách khắc phục

Trong quá trình xác thực OTP, đôi khi người dùng có thể gặp phải một số lỗi như mã không đúng thời gian hay không nhận được mã. Để khắc phục, người dùng có thể:

  • Kiểm tra kết nối mạng và đảm bảo rằng họ đang ở nơi có tín hiệu.
  • Đảm bảo số điện thoại hoặc email đã đăng ký là chính xác.
  • Nếu mã OTP không hoạt động, yêu cầu hệ thống gửi mã OTP mới.
See also  Ghost là gì? Tìm hiểu ý nghĩa, vai trò và sự hiện diện của Ghost trong đời sống và văn hóa

8. Cách tạo mã OTP

Việc tạo mã OTP có thể được thực hiện bằng cách sử dụng các công cụ và thư viện sẵn có. Lập trình viên có thể áp dụng các thuật toán như TOTP (Time-based One-Time Password) và HOTP (HMAC-based One-Time Password) để phát sinh mã. Dưới đây là một số công cụ hữu ích cho việc tạo mã OTP:

  • Google Authenticator: Ứng dụng phổ biến để tạo mã OTP dùng cho nhiều dịch vụ khác nhau.
  • Dịch vụ Smart OTP: Nhiều ngân hàng cung cấp tính năng này, cho phép người dùng nhận mã OTP trực tiếp từ ứng dụng của họ.

9. Ứng dụng của OTP

OTP không chỉ được ứng dụng trong lĩnh vực ngân hàng, mà còn trong nhiều lĩnh vực khác. Ví dụ điển hình bao gồm:

  • Mạng xã hội: Facebook, Google và nhiều nền tảng khác sử dụng OTP để xác thực đăng nhập của người dùng.
  • Doanh nghiệp: Các hệ thống quản lý truy cập trong doanh nghiệp thường áp dụng OTP như một biện pháp bảo mật.
  • E-commerce: Các trang thương mại điện tử cũng sử dụng OTP để bảo vệ thông tin thanh toán của khách hàng.

10. Kết luận

OTP đã trở thành một giải pháp bảo mật quan trọng trong thời đại số hóa. Việc sử dụng OTP không chỉ giúp bảo vệ tài khoản của người dùng mà còn tăng cường an tâm khi thực hiện giao dịch trực tuyến. Chúng tôi khuyến nghị bạn nên tích hợp OTP vào các tài khoản quan trọng và không chia sẻ mã OTP với bất kỳ ai để đảm bảo mức độ an toàn cao nhất cho thông tin cá nhân.

Kết bài

Trong thế giới ngày càng số hóa, việc bảo vệ tài khoản và thông tin cá nhân là điều vô cùng cần thiết. OTP đã chứng minh được vai trò quan trọng trong việc bảo vệ không chỉ tài khoản mà còn cả sự an toàn của mỗi người dùng. Hãy áp dụng OTP trong cuộc sống hàng ngày của bạn để tăng cường bảo mật và an toàn cho tài khoản cá nhân.

Ứng dụng của OTP

“`